What is Unicode character 𬀱?

The Unicode character 𬀱 U+2C031 is Cjk Unified Ideograph- in the CJK Unified Ideographs Extension E block.

What does the Unicode character 𬀱 represent?

The Unicode character 𬀱 represents Cjk Unified Ideograph-.

What is the Unicode code point for 𬀱?

The Unicode code point for 𬀱 is U+2C031.

Is the appearance of the 𬀱 character consistent across all platforms?

The appearance of the 𬀱 character can vary slightly across different platforms and devices due to differences in font and rendering. However, the general design of the Cjk Unified Ideograph- remains consistent.

How can I ensure the 𬀱 character displays correctly on different devices?

Though using Unicode ensures consistent display across devices and platforms. Ensure that the font being used supports the Han script to correctly render the 𬀱 character.

In which version was Unicode character 𬀱 released, and to which block of characters does it belong?

Unicode character 𬀱 was first introduced in Unicode Version 8.0, and it belongs to the CJK Unified Ideographs Extension E block of characters.
